Which one of the following is not a cold current ?

Brazil current
Benguela current
Peru current
Labrador current

The correct answer is (a), Brazil current.

The Brazil current is a warm water current that flows southward along the eastern coast of South America, from the equator to the Tropic of Capricorn. It is part of the South Atlantic Gyre, a large system of rotating ocean currents that circulates the waters of the South Atlantic Ocean.

The Benguela current is a cold water current that flows northward along the western coast of Africa, from the Cape of Good Hope to Angola. It is part of the Benguela–Angola Current System, a large system of rotating ocean currents that circulates the waters of the South Atlantic Ocean.

The Peru current is a cold water current that flows southward along the western coast of South America, from the equator to the Tropic of Capricorn. It is part of the Humboldt Current System, a large system of rotating ocean currents that circulates the waters of the Pacific Ocean.

The Labrador current is a cold water current that flows southward along the eastern coast of Canada, from the Arctic Ocean to Newfoundland. It is part of the North Atlantic Gyre, a large system of rotating ocean currents that circulates the waters of the North Atlantic Ocean.

As you can see, all of the options except (a) are cold water currents. Therefore, the correct answer is (a).
